Associated Cost

If you start using the PHP, you don’t have to spend a dime since it’s an open-source framework. Being free doesn’t mean it is not powerful enough to meet the developer’s requirements. Popular platforms like Facebook, Twitter, Word press etc. relies on PHP language. The developers love to create a unique project with zero cost. And when it comes to PHP, you are getting the opportunity to build a website by using the premium features of this language. So, those who are looking for a powerful free framework, PHP might be the best solution.

Versatility

One of the key reasons for which PHP Software development has gain huge popularity lies within its versatility. If you develop a web-based application or software-based using different language, you are going to have integration issues. But PHP language allows you to work seamlessly for different popular platforms like UNIX, Linux, and Windows. Furthermore, you can also use the language to integrate complex applications to MySQL or Apace. The developers love to work with versatility and PHP seems to meet the standard requirement of the programmers.

Vast Community

If you are looking at the PHP community, you will be surprised to see its free online resources. Start from the starters ending with the skilled programmers, everyone is sharing their knowledge via articles, posts, and video tutorials. So, if you ran into a problem, you can expect to get the perfect solution which is very hard to find in other languages.

Since this is an open-source programming language you don’t have to think about spending money to learn new things.
